                                <p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edias-qtt-taps-digital-ad-dollars-for-local-cable">QTT, a division of Viamedia,</a> is launching a platform where buyers can access linear television advertising inventory for data-driven advertising.</p><p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/nick-davatzes-founder-of-ae-networks-dead-at-79">A+E Networks</a>, Fox and Reelz are the first TV network participants in the QTT Marketplace.</p><p>Magnite is the initial supply-side platform working with the QTT marketplace.</p><p>“The last mile to activate linear TV advertising through existing digital platforms is finally here,” said <a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edia-hires-piccone-as-head-of-qtt-division">John Piccone, president of QTT</a>. “Buyers and sellers can now take advantage of their investments in data-driven audience planning tools by activating at scale through QTT’s seamless translation platform. As a result, we now have an array of partners offering premium television inventory through demand- and sell-side platforms to connect them directly with traditional and new digital advertisers.”</p><p>The marketplace gives TV networks access to the growing volume of digital video ad add dollars.</p><p>"A+E Networks has been on the forefront in building scalable demand-side partnerships,” said Ethan Heftman, senior VP, advanced advertising and digital sales at A+E Networks. “QTT and its Marketplace are a one-two punch that automates access to new demand while ensuring control over our pricing and inventory.”</p><p>“At Fox, we continue to find ways to better serve our clients and look for solutions to drive incremental yield while reducing the workflow efforts to leverage our advanced TV technologies,” said Dan Callahan, senior VP, data strategy and sales innovation for Fox. “Earlier this year, we partnered with Operative to move all linear sales to a single cloud system and, in turn, this allowed a seamless partnership with QTT to connect specific cable network linear avails to digital ad platforms.”</p><p>“More and more digital advertisers are looking to linear TV to increase their reach efficiently,” said Bill Rosolie, senior VP, advertising sales at ReelzChannel. “We see QTT as a platform to unlock the value of target-rich audiences across our portfolio of independent networks.”</p><p>The QTT Marketplace is an extension of QTT software developed to allow agencies and media buyers to see the linear ads made available by MVPDs, broadcast television stations and broadcast and cable networks. The launch follows <a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/qtt-gets-third-patent-for-linking-tv-ad-marketplaces"><u>QTT getting patents </u></a>for the process it uses to integrate digital and linear television ecosystems.</p><p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/tag/magnite">Magnite</a> developed its own process that complement’s QTT’s technology and allows QTT inventory to be bought programmatically based on TV metrics. </p><p>“Our clients have been asking for streamlined tools to enable programmatic monetization of their linear inventory and complement their CTV advertising efforts,“ said Todd Randak, senior VP, strategy and partnerships at Magnite. “With QTT we can now offer premium linear TV opportunities through the Magnite platform as if they were any other digital video ad.”</p>

                                <p>QTT, an ad-tech division of Viamedia, received a third patent for its process of bridging the gap between linear TV and digital advertising. </p><p>The company said the patent, U.S No. 11,057,134 for “Integrating Digital Advertising with Cable TV Network and Broadcast Advertising” is part of solving the last-mile challenges facing marketers mounting cross-platform campaigns.</p><p>The new patent <a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edias-qtt-taps-digital-ad-dollars-for-local-cable">enables a connection to broadcast and cable programmers and their ad inventory</a>, increasing digital-first advertisers’ access to local linear TV inventory from two minutes per hour, as enabled by last year’s patent, to 15 minutes per hour nationally.   </p><p>“QTT is a win-win for advertisers and linear TV companies alike,” said<a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edia-hires-piccone-as-head-of-qtt-division"> John Piccone, president of QTT. </a></p><p>“Local and national television inventory suppliers own the lion’s share of premium, fraud-free video advertising inventory.  But digital-only advertisers have not been able to access this premium inventory through the demand-side platforms where they currently purchase all other digital media,” Piccone said. “There are many more digital advertisers than TV advertisers and this development allows all of those digital advertisers to access TV inventory and to avail themselves of brand-safe options that improve the efficiency and effectiveness of their budgets.” </p><p>QTT’s cloud-based technology converts a digital ad call into a linear TV placement. QTT’s solution facilitates private marketplace deals with local broadcasters and broadcast and cable networks.</p><p>“This completes the last mile that has been missing from previous efforts to connect the largest pool of premium video advertising inventory to DSPs and SSPs -- while giving inventory owners control of the process,” said Randy Lykes, CTO of QTT parent Viamedia and who is named on the patent. “QTT solves this by making advertising standards interoperable.”</p><p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edia-gets-patent-for-qtt-ad-platform">QTT received its first patent</a>--U.S. 10,757,462, which enabled MVPDs to connect to digital-first advertisers via DSPs and SSPs, in August 2020. Its second patent--11,012,758--was granted in May and described a system for having digital advertising triggered by cable TV cue messages. </p>

                                <figure class="van-image-figure pull-" data-bordeaux-image-check ><div class='image-full-width-wrapper'><div class='image-widthsetter' ><p class="vanilla-image-block" style="padding-top:56.25%;"><img id="emXxHroBYDtPSrZwmSfCS7" name="" alt="John Piccone" src="https://cdn.mos.cms.futurecdn.net/emXxHroBYDtPSrZwmSfCS7.jpg" mos="https://cdn.mos.cms.futurecdn.net/emXxHroBYDtPSrZwmSfCS7.jpg" align="" fullscreen="" width="" height="" attribution="" endorsement="" class="pull-"></p></div></div><figcaption itemprop="caption description" class="pull-"><span class="caption-text">John Piccone </span></figcaption></figure><p>Viamedia, which sells ad inventory for local cable operators, said it hired John Piccone as president of its new QTT division.</p><p>QTT requests and receives ads programmatically from ad exchanges which are inserted in real time into linear cable TV channels, bringing new digital marketing dollars to local cable.</p><p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edias-qtt-taps-digital-ad-dollars-for-local-cable">Related: Viamedia's QTT Taps Digital Ad Dollars for Local Cable</a></p><p>Piccone most recently had been president and chief revenue officer of Simulmedia, a pioneer in selling data-targeted linear TV. As president of QTT, he will be responsible for its overall business, product, communications and marketing strategy.</p><p>“Having been an advisor to QTT for several months now, John has demonstrated that he is a dynamic leader whose extensive experience and insight will be invaluable as we continue to expand our QTT™ offering,” said Viamedia CEO Mark Lieberman. “The technical results from our initial market trials and integrations with our MVPD partners have been stellar. QTT is bringing us one step closer to the full convergence of TV and digital advertising, and John is the right man to help us get there.”</p><p><a href="https://www.nexttv.com/news/viamedia-completes-live-test-of-linear-programmatic-product">Related: Viamedia Completes Live Test of Linear Programmatic Product</a></p><p>Before Simlmedia, Piccone held pots with Innovid, HealthiNation, BlackArrow and 24/7 Real Media.</p><p>“I am very excited at the opportunity of helping bring the digital and linear television advertising worlds together,” Piccone said. “QTT is a complete game changer. For years, the marketplace has been waiting for a simple solution to allow digital advertising platforms to buy linear TV advertising while respecting the existing business rules that have made television advertising so powerful. With QTT, the wait is over. This is the opportunity of a lifetime, and I’m honored to be a part of it.”</p><p>Viamedia also said that Brendan Condon, most recently chief revenue officer for Comcast’s Effectv, is acting as a strategic advisor. He will work with cable operators and agency heads to help drive adoption of QTT.</p>
